Anyone ever heard of these people? They approached my parents to advertise their timeshare for sale in Tenerife for free, so they did and have today approached them saying they have found a buyer who is willing to pay £3000 for a one week timeshare apartment. Anyone had any dealings? Their website is shoddy to say the least: https://www.travelworld.co.uk.
